Hroar ​​Stjernen (born February 11, 1961 in Beitstad ) is a former Norwegian ski jumper and today's ski jumping official.

Career

Stjernen took part in international competitions from 1984 to 1989. He achieved his only World Cup victory in 1985 in Bischofshofen . At the Nordic World Ski Championships in 1987 in Oberstdorf , he won the silver medal with the team and was fourth in the individual competition on the normal hill.

He later worked as the sports director of the Norwegian national ski jumping team. After the team's poor performance at the Four Hills Tournament in 2002, he resigned from his post a few days after coach Ludvik Zajc . Previously, Stjernen had achieved the commitment of Mika Kojonkoski as a coach for the new season, but this was kept secret until the end of the season. Later Stjernen was again under discussion as sports director, but could not prevail against Clas Brede Bråthen . Today he is active as the technical delegate of the FIS in ski jumping competitions.

His son Andreas Stjernen was also active as a ski jumper until 2019.
